Specimen Summary: Crystal Habits & Morphology
The micro specimens in this batch showcase the iconic crystal habits that make Round Mountain gold globally famous among mineralogists:
0.08g Specimen (Far Left): Classic spinel-law twin / dendritic skeletal habit. It displays distinct branching parallel growth (herringbone pattern) with sharp micro-octahedral edges along the edges.
0.16g Specimen (Middle Left): Dense dendritic plate / micro-octahedral cluster. A tight aggregate of intergrown micro-crystals exhibiting high luster and complex 3D surface geometry.
0.13g Specimen (Middle Right): Micro-crystalline gold on white quartz matrix. Features a bright gold ribbon wrapping across a clean quartz grain, offering high visual contrast.
0.14g Specimen (Far Right): Arborescent gold on matrix. Exhibits feather-like crystal growth emerging directly from a quartz base.
Placer / Micro Crystals (Top Tray): A loose batch of classic micro-dendritic leaves, flattened micro-octahedrons, and crystalline flakes.
History & Locality Highlights: Round Mountain Mine
Discovery & Hardrock Beginnings: Gold was first discovered at Round Mountain in Nye County, Nevada, in 1906. Early miners pursued high-grade underground quartz veins, uncovering some of the most intricate native gold crystal habits ever documented.
Geological Marvel: The deposit formed within an epithermal quartz-adularia vein system hosted in volcanic rhyolite tuff. Rapid precipitation of gold from high-temperature fluids allowed free-standing, skeletal, herringbone, and octahedral twin crystals to form in open vugs without being crushed by rock pressure.
Modern Mega-Mine: In 1977, the site transitioned into a massive open-pit heap-leach operation. Over its lifetime, Round Mountain has produced over 10 million ounces of gold, making it one of the largest and longest-running gold mines in North American history.
The Specimen Rarity: Because modern industrial open-pit mining uses heavy machinery and chemical leaching (crushing ore to fine dust), true preserved crystalline specimens from Round Mountain—especially hand-picked, pocket-recovered material—are increasingly scarce and highly sought after by collectors.
